Tourist Attractions in Lake Como

Broletto

Broletto

The Broletto is an ancient seat of the Palazzo Comunale di Como, it is located in Via Vittorio Emanuele II.  »

Villa Carlotta

Villa Carlotta

Villa Carlotta is a unique place of rare beauty, where natural masterpieces and incredible works of human intellect live together in perfect harmony into over 70000 square metres between stunning gardens and museums.  »

Villa del Balbianello

Villa del Balbianello

Villa del Balbianello is located on top of a woody hill called Dosso di Lavedo.  »

Villa Melzi

Villa Melzi

Francesco Melzi d'Eril, duke of Lodi and vice-president of the Italian Republic at the time of Napoleon (1801-1803), like many other powerful Milanese families, built a huge formal residence with park in Bellagio.  »

Villa Olmo

Villa Olmo

Villa Olmo owes its name to a magnificent centenary elm tree, today no longer existent.  »

Villa Serbelloni

Villa Serbelloni

Suggestive monument which stand on the promontory of Bellagio where, according to the legend, Plinius the Younger owned a villa called Tragedia (tragedy).  »
